Liverpool’s Memorable 5-1 Win in 2006

Today’s challenge takes us back to a memorable moment from March 2006, when Rafa Benitez’s Liverpool team cruised to a 5-1 victory over Fulham.

The match was special not only for the dominant scoreline but also for the fact that five different players scored for the Reds that day.

How to Play Teamsheet

The goal of the game is simple: try to score as few points as possible. Here’s how it works:

  • When you guess a player correctly on your first try, you score just one point.
  • For each subsequent guess, if you get the letter in the correct position, it will turn green. If the letter is correct but in the wrong position, it will turn yellow.
  • You have six guesses to figure out each player. If you fail, we’ll reveal the player’s identity, and you’ll score a hefty 11 points.
  • Need a little help? You can ask for a free letter, but be warned—it will cost you one point.

The aim is to get the lowest score possible, ideally hitting that perfect total of 11 points if you guess every player correctly on the first try.
